Title :
Observation of a free-electron laser interaction in the UHF regime

Abstract :
A free-electron laser (FEL) oscillator experiment operating with a low-energy (<4 keV), low-current (<0.5 A) pulsed electron beam is presented in this paper. In the table-top FEL oscillator constructed in our laboratory the electrons travel along a planar undulator and an axial magnetic field, and interact with TEM-mode electromagnetic waves. In this experiment, microwave output is observed at /spl sim/40 cm wavelength. This radiation is much longer than the undulator period (2 cm). To the best of our knowledge, this is the first demonstration of an FEL operation in the UHF regime. For electron beam energy of /spl sim/3 keV, we observe also microwave output at /spl sim/5 GHz. This emission is related to the cyclotron resonance due to the axial magnetic field. These experiments may lead to the development of new high-power UHF and microwave radiation sources.
